Enjoy all a 72-square-mile scenic lake offers, from kayaking and swimming to relaxing on the beach, when you book your vacation at the Wolfeboro Inn, a unique destination on Lake Winnipesaukee. Consistently acclaimed among the best places to stay in the Lakes Region, this historic inn is located in a charming lakeside town with shops, boutiques and galleries. Lake activities include canoeing, paddle boarding, water skiing and tubing and fishing. You can explore New England’s largest lake aboard the Winnipesaukee Belle, a 65-foot replica of a turn-of-the-century paddle-wheeled boat. Dine in the historic Wolfe’s Tavern, an authentic New England pub, and stay in one of the inn’s 44 guest rooms and suites, some with lake views.

At Migis Lodge on Sebago Lake, guests have been enjoying that classic New England vacation for over 100 years, staying in the Main Lodge’s eight lake-view rooms or in 35 comfortable private cottages with fieldstone fireplaces. Pristine Sebago Lake provides fun activities including water skiing, kayaking, canoeing and fishing. Sail a classic Sunfish sailboat, go paddle boarding or take the family out on a pontoon boat. With all your meals taken care of by the Full American Plan, you’ll have more time to relax by the lake, get a massage at the wellness center, book a fishing guide or a private lesson with a tennis pro. Kids’ camps are supervised fun times that feature nature walks, swimming and arts and crafts.

At the Attean Lake Lodge, an all-inclusive island retreat on the loveliest lake in Maine, guests seeking to unplug from their busy lives will find complete paradise. Without electricity (the lodge has solar power and the cabins have gasoline and kerosene lights), guests find they can breathe easier in the Maine air, relaxing in the evening in one of 14 cozy cabins with fireplaces and comfortable beds, listening to the sound of the loons. Lake activities include fishing for trout and salmon; kayaking, canoeing and paddle boarding; beach games and swimming. Hike the 20 miles of maintained trails take a boat and a picnic lunch to a beach or mountain top; or ask about scheduling a sea plane excursion or moose cruise.
